Domestic violence victims have special rental provisions. California tenants who are victims of stalking, sexual violence or domestic violence can terminate their lease early under the California landlord-tenant law (Cal. Civ. Code &167; 1946.7). Landlords are entitled to verify any claims of domestic violence.

If a lease is broken early without justification, you may typically collect the remaining rent on that lease term. This means that if a tenant leaves a 1-year lease after 8 months, you may collect the final 4 months of unpaid rent from them. However, you are legally required to look for a replacement tenant and work to mitigate the damages.

Consequences for Breaking Your Commercial Lease. Because the amount of rent owed when a tenant breaks their commercial lease can be substantial, a landlord will likely sue in superior court rather than small claims court. If this is the case, the tenant may be liable for the landlords attorney fees if they lose at trial.
